Today I thought I would let you in on some of my favorite Currey and Co lights.  They are a Georgia company....family owned so I feel a little kinship to them.

The first one is the Saxon Chandelier.  It's huge and don't let the style fool you....when it's hung it can really make a statement!


This image was the first time I saw it used.  I tried to find the source.



This is my second favorite the Brussels Chandelier.  I have loved it ever since Jill Sharp used it over her kitchen island in Charleston.







Next up is the Ringmaster Chandelier.  I used this one in Michaels Ladisics living room and it is a show stopper.






I recently used these pendants over the island at my Madison project and fell in love!





Nobody loves a rattan fixture more than me and this one is no exception.  I used it in a large vaulted family room and it's a stunner when lit!



I have the sconce version of this pendant and after 4 years still LOVE them.....
